Running a Bricklayer Business in Scarborough
Scarborough's building trade thrives on two distinct markets. Victorian and Edwardian terraces dominate the town centre and seafront properties, where holiday let owners invest heavily in external restoration and structural repairs. Inland towards Filey and Pickering, newer residential developments and agricultural conversions keep bricklayers busy year-round. The seasonal tourism economy means many property owners plan summer refurbishments—and many need invoices quickly to claim back costs before the next tax return.
